Yah I eyed that Hypo Lavender and the Amel stripe. though I don't have room for any more adults at the moment.
and the guy selling the Amel really didn't seem to have a clue - told me it was an "amel stripe het motley"

I had a guy pull a 6 foot Taiwanese Beauty snake out of his pocket (yes, pants pocket) and hand her to me. He said he'd worked with her a lot to get her used to handling, a surprisingly calm (but active) snake
and I didn't know that Hognoses have rough (keeled maybe?) scales sort of like Garter snakes!
